Clockwise Review

Clockwise is an AI calendar optimization tool that automatically rearranges meetings to protect focus time and reduce scheduling conflicts.

Verdict

Clockwise is a well-established AI scheduling platform that integrates with Google and Outlook Calendar to intelligently defend deep-work blocks, auto-schedule meetings in optimal slots, and surface team availability. It competes directly with Reclaim.ai in the AI calendar space and is known for its focus-time protection. The main tradeoff is that advanced features like team scheduling and analytics sit behind paid tiers, and it is most valuable in calendar-heavy, collaborative environments.

Pros & cons

Pros
  • Automatically protects focus time
  • Team scheduling coordination
  • Google & Outlook integration
Cons
  • Advanced features require paid plan
  • Less useful without teammates on the platform
